Foreign Language Proficiency Exam and Exemptions

Students enrolled in diploma programs taught in a foreign language are required to take the Foreign Language Proficiency Exam administered by YADYO.

The Foreign Language Proficiency Exam is graded out of 100 points, and students who achieve at least the minimum scores specified in Table 1 are exempt from the mandatory foreign language preparatory class and gain direct admission to their registered diploma programs.

Students who meet at least one of the following conditions are exempt from the Foreign Language Proficiency Exam and can directly enroll in their diploma programs:

(a) Those who have completed at least the last three years of their secondary education in secondary schools where the designated foreign language is spoken as the native language and attended by citizens of that country, or those who have completed the International Baccalaureate (IB), ABITUR, or French Baccalaureate Diploma Programs in Turkey.

(b) Those who have obtained at least the minimum score specified in Table 2 from one of the listed exams.

(c) Those who have previously studied in a foreign language preparatory program at another higher education institution and successfully completed their education at B2 (Upper-Intermediate) level or above, obtaining the minimum required score specified in Table 1 out of 100 points.

Placement Exam

Students who do not take the Foreign Language Proficiency Exam or those who fail to achieve the minimum required scores are required to take the Placement Exam.

Based on their scores in the Placement Exam, students are placed in the appropriate level of the foreign language preparatory class.

Students who do not take or are unable to take the Placement Exam start their foreign language preparatory class education at the lowest level.

There is no make-up exam for the Foreign Language Proficiency Exam or the Placement Exam.

Compulsory English Courses for Departments with Turkish as the Language of Instruction

To be exempt from mandatory foreign language courses, students must pass the Exemption Exam conducted by YADYOat the beginning of the fall and spring semesters. Exemption Exams are only administered for courses that cover general English content.

The Exemption Exam is graded out of 100 points, and students who score:

  • 70 points are exempt from the fall semester mandatory foreign language course.
  • 80 points are exempt from both the fall and spring semester mandatory foreign language courses with an "AA" grade.

To be exempt from the mandatory English courses specified in Table 3, students must obtain at least the minimum required scores from the exams listed in the table.

Students who successfully complete the previous mandatory foreign language course with 80 points or higher, or those who have been exempted from the previous mandatory foreign language course with an “AA” grade, are eligible to take the exemption exam for the subsequent mandatory foreign language course.

Students who have successfully completed the foreign language preparatory program at another higher education institution and enrolled in Turkish-medium undergraduate programs are exempt from mandatory English courses equivalent to their completed preparatory program level with an "AA" grade.

Those who have not successfully completed another institution’s foreign language preparatory program must have scored at least 80 out of 100 in the last successfully completed level to be exempt from the relevant mandatory English courses with an "AA" grade.

Students who have previously studied at another higher education institution may be granted exemption from mandatory foreign language courses based on grade equivalency determined by the faculty/school executive board. Exemption procedures are carried out in accordance with the Maltepe University Associate and Undergraduate Education, Teaching, and Examination Regulations.

Foreign Language Preparatory Class Achievement Assessment

The assessment of success in the foreign language preparatory class is conducted annually.

The year-end achievement grade is calculated based on the mid-term exams, quizzes, oral exams, class participation, and other in-term assessments, combined with the final exam grade.

This calculation is performed by multiplying each assessment component by its weight in the final grade and summing the results. The final score is rounded to the nearest whole number.

The weight of in-term assessments and the final exam in the final grade is determined by YADYO and announced to students at the beginning of the academic year.

To successfully complete the preparatory class, students must score at least 50/100 in the final exam.

Students who fail at the end of the academic year are eligible to take the make-up exam. The make-up exam score replaces the final exam score in the overall grade calculation.

Students who achieve the minimum required score specified in Table 1 are considered to have successfully completed the foreign language preparatory class.

Foreign Language Proficiency Exam for Early Completion

Students studying at the B2 level and students in the first semester whose cumulative scores from the assessments announced at the beginning of the academic year meet the following criteria out of 100 points:

  • 90 points or above for A1 level students
  • 80 points or above for A2 level students
  • 70 points or above for B1 level students

are eligible to take the Foreign Language Proficiency Exam at the end of the fall semester.

Students who obtain the minimum scores specified in Table 1 in this exam successfully complete the foreign language preparatory class and gain the right to proceed to their respective faculties in the spring semester.
